The Collision: A Maritime Crisis in the North Sea

The collision took place in the North Sea, an essential shipping corridor that connects ports in Europe and beyond, particularly those in the United Kingdom, Norway, and the Netherlands. On the fateful day of the incident, the cargo ship, which was carrying a significant load of goods from a European port to another international destination, collided with a U.S.-flagged tanker that was en route to a refinery in the United States.

According to reports from maritime authorities, the collision occurred under relatively clear weather conditions, although some reports suggest poor visibility due to sudden changes in fog. The cargo ship, identified as a Panamanian-flagged vessel, collided with the tanker, causing significant damage to both ships, including a hole in the hull of the cargo vessel and a substantial dent in the side of the U.S. tanker. The accident led to a minor oil spill but no casualties, though the situation could have been much worse.

The collision prompted an immediate response from rescue teams and maritime authorities in the region. While the cargo ship was able to maintain its course and reach a nearby port for assessment, the U.S. tanker was towed to a safe harbor for repairs. Initial investigations revealed that both ships had sustained considerable damage, but thankfully no crew members on either vessel were seriously injured.

Given the prominence of both vessels and the location of the accident in a heavily trafficked shipping lane, maritime authorities quickly moved to investigate the circumstances that led to the collision. The inquiry, which includes input from both national and international agencies, has focused heavily on the actions of the cargo ship’s crew, with particular attention given to the ship’s captain, whose role in the incident would be pivotal in determining the cause of the accident.

The Arrest of the Cargo Ship’s Captain: A Russian National

In the days following the collision, maritime authorities arrested the captain of the cargo ship. The captain, identified as a Russian national, was taken into custody under suspicion of negligence and violations of maritime safety regulations. According to the ship’s owner, the captain had been operating the vessel at the time of the collision, and investigators were keen to determine whether human error, miscommunication, or other factors contributed to the incident.

The arrest of the Russian national captain has sparked widespread attention, particularly in light of the geopolitical tensions surrounding Russia’s actions on the global stage. The timing of the arrest, coming amid ongoing tensions between Russia and the West, has raised concerns among analysts about the potential diplomatic ramifications of the incident. However, maritime experts stress that the investigation should focus primarily on the specifics of the accident rather than any broader political context.

The cargo ship’s owner has expressed full cooperation with authorities, stating that they are committed to uncovering the cause of the incident and ensuring that justice is served. However, the company has also stated that the captain’s arrest, without a clear public explanation of the exact reasons for his detention, has complicated their operations. They emphasized that the captain, who had been with the company for several years and was considered an experienced mariner, had always adhered to industry standards and regulations in the past.
